Coxe and Graziano Hosts Dog Adoption Event Over the Weekend

The Greenwich Free Press hosted a multi organization animal adoption event on Saturday July 11 at Coxe & Graziano Funeral Home. Dogs and cats from Adopt-A-Dog, Northwind Kennels, Passionworks Rescue, Rising Rin Dove, STAR Relief and Cat Assistance were on site for the community to meet. All of the animals at the event were available for adoption and applications were on scene to start to process if interested.

“A lot of the pets here were pulled from kill shelters, they were actually on the euthanasia list. They’re amazing animals, they would make amazing companions, great house pets and are great with kids. It’s really important to come out and adopt instead of purchasing from a pet store, that’s the most important thing,” said Heather Scutti.

There are many advantages to adopting from rescue groups like the ones here today.

“When you come down to a rescue group most of the pets are fostered so they’re living with a family so you already know what you’re going to get. You know the pet’s temperament, they’re up to date on vaccinations, they’re neutered. Those are important issues when you want to adopt a pet, the rescue groups will educate you all about the pet,” said Heather Scutti.
